The standard equation of direct variation is
y = kx
where k = constant of variation
We start with
y = kx
Since we are give one ordered pair, we use its coordinates for x and y, and we solve for k. We are told that when x = 14 ounces, y = $7.
7 = k * 14
k = 7/14
k = 1/2
Now that we know k = 1/2, we can write the direct variation equation:
